Historical & Cultural Background

The name Vanburen is of Dutch origin, meaning 'from Buren,' which is a town in the Netherlands. It is a toponymic surname that indicates geographical roots. The name has historical significance in the United States, particularly due to Martin Van Buren, the eighth President of the United States, who was a key figure in the formation of the Democratic Party.
